Bill Summary

Various election law matters. Eliminates the small precinct committee. Requires, not later than July 1, 2018, that the election commission adopt an order consolidating precincts in Lake County having fewer than 600 active voters, if the consolidation will realize savings for the county and not impose unreasonable obstacles on the ability of the voters of the county to vote at the polls. Provides that, if the commission does not adopt an order, the secretary of state, not later than August 1, 2018, and not later than July 1 each year immediately following a presidential election, shall issue the order. AI Summary

This bill: - Eliminates the small precinct committee and requires the secretary of state to issue an order by August 1, 2018 and annually after presidential elections to consolidate precincts in Lake County with fewer than 600 active voters, if the consolidation will realize savings for the county without imposing unreasonable obstacles on voters. - Allows absentee ballot counting procedures to be conducted at any time after receipt of an absentee ballot in certain counties, rather than waiting until after the polls close on election day. - Requires county election boards to compile and publish information on the number of votes cast and the number of voters at each precinct, and conduct audits if there is a significant difference between those numbers. The bill aims to streamline election administration and reduce costs, particularly in the processing of absentee ballots, while maintaining reasonable access to voting at the polls.
